[Help] New DS emulator Rensata

Hello guys!
I'm Carlos Lindeman from Brazil and since 2015 I'm developing an Nintendo DS emulator. Everything started when a co-worker was playing Super Smash Bros on his notebook in the breaktime, I was amazed by the performance of the emulator (Dolphin), the last time I tried to emulate something (at the time) was at least 10 years before. And in the moment I discovered it was opensource and looked at the source, man! I was amazed how such a brillant work could be done, it was nothing compared to every single software I developed since I started in this area ('95), so I started to search about emulation and other emulators, and became amazed with a lot of them, PPSSPP for its structure, NO$GBA for being absurdly written in assembly, Gambatte for it's accuracy. But I noted that no DS emulators (at least Open Source) was well... Friendly written? I looked at the Desmume Source and it was a mess... NO$ despite being incredible for being written in assembly wasn't opensource nor portable, so I tought, why not? Thankfully I had some experience with the ARM architecture in the past, so I started what I call "Rensata", yeah I don't have any creativity for names.

Attached: download.jpg (235x214, 9K)

Other urls found in this thread:

google.com/search?q=No$Zoomer
twitter.com/SFWRedditImages

My first objective was to make it work, I got to this in 2016 when I got Mario 64DS to boot! So I started to work with the "GPU" side, and got a software render that renders pretty well a hundred of games now. In the begin of 2017 I refactored every part of the code and mostly rewrote the ARM's interpreters (and got a huge performance boost, 300% the original DS velocity on an old Pentium 4), so I set another goal, an JIT to speed up things a little (and grant performance on portable devices)! At the current time I'm finishing the details of the JIT, and starting to work on a new renderer (with OpenGL3) and in the reversal enginnering of some common libraries embbeded on most DS games. I plan to release it to public at the moment the JIT is finished, so that way with a few adjusts it could be ported to every platform possible (at least in theory, I designed the JIT core directly with 3 modules, X86, X86_64 and ARM64, I don't know much about PowerPC and other architectures, but I think it'll work).
But at the moment I have one single problem... I worked to the same company since 1999, but it closed doors the begin of this year, and at least in my city I haven't find a job that pay the same nor that actually uses most of my experience (I worked all this time with C and C++), all the Java I knows seems to be at the same level of recently graduate students that can earn a starter salary, so at the moment I'm earning just to live and hardly pay my children school.

The thing is, I found out that some details of GBATek (the major source of information I used til now) have some parts not so acurrated, and I got to test this with a osciloscope of my alma mater, but I can't use it for my personal research without goverment authorization, and well, they didn't authorize me. So I'm keeping to buy one myself, but I can hardly keep any money each month, so I'm here to ask for your help! There's an osciloscope from Rigol that costs 350 USD on Amazon, but got an offer from a acquitance in Canada for 300 USD, with taxes it would cost me next to 600 USD (Yeah, Brazil import taxes are absurd, they tax everything (minus books and medicine)). That's a month of my salary, and the way I'm it will be 3 years to keep this ammount. So I'm asking for your help!
Any amount will be really appreciated! And if you donate, mail me and the moment the JIT get completed (Probably August), you'll receive a beta build, and if you are interested the access to the repository, and when every single test of JIT be OK will release it to public (September?). I know that I may sound just like an odd asking you for money, but well, the only guarantee I can give is my word. People said to me open an Patreon, but it won't work right now, since there's no source or public build, It would be nonsense. Well, that's it, thanks for hearing about my work and plans!

Email: carloslindeman1(at)outlook(dot)com

Nice blog, no one cares, now fuck off monkey

Attached: 3d2.jpg (317x699, 44K)

hi, i'm nigera prince
i send you million, just need you pay for transfer fee
k thanks

Is it free as in freedom?

>i did all these things
>"there's no source"
seems legit

I think you're looking for instead.

>pic
that guys fucks

upvoted

pics or gtfo

Leddit jokes XD

...

Just try to post this on .

Jow Forums is full of retard who hate "video game" without reason.

>gullible retard
OP showed no proof of anything. Merely a shitty sob story asking for money. If he had actual code to show or anything of worth, you'd see people at least interested in it. Since it's just random ramblings in broken English asking for money, he'll get deservedly mocked.

takes one redditard to recognize another

S O P A

Mesmo acreditando que seja bait, tente o eles podem te ajudar. Praticamente ninguém sabe programar por aqui, e muito menos vão te ajudar com algo mais avançado que um fizzbuzz.

Attached: 1516233975379.jpg (657x527, 32K)

emugen here, we don't want him

Also Ensata (drop the R) is an in-house Nintendo DS emulator

UMA DELICIA

Why do you need a sillyscope

Why? There are 500,000 DS emulators

>osciloscope
yer you don't need a oscilloscope to make a emulator this story is BS any thing of value has already been reversed engineered from the DS this guys just asking for cash.

UMA

Staplebutter made a fully functional DS emulator in the rec room of a mental hospital. What's your excuse?

Man what the fuck this was pretty nice to read but you're just some guy asking for money and with absolutely nothing to show

idai men mo barato um ds kkkkk '-'

you'd have more success shilling your idea on plebbit
also start a kikestarter or patreon

I'm using a two year old samsung phone with a free DS emulator on it Right now, tell why i should read your blog past the first sentence ?
In the emulation world either you're firt or you're nothing.

it's either slow or written 'unfriendly'. pick 1

So dumb brown people think they'll get somewhere trying to scam autistic poorfags on a tech board?
Kys monkey retard

i wouldn't know. silicon valley is an ok show.

nice job Carlos.

Ganbatte Carlos! Ds emulation sucks, that's why I bought a 3Ds, you barely can play games like Hotel Dusk or Ghost Trick on emulators because the poor sound quality or the fps drops that makes really annoying.

Wish you luck, fren.

Attached: DMxzD59VoAARrg5.jpg (858x1200, 83K)

>there's no source or public build
found your problem.

Literal begging for money: the post. If you need an oscilloscope that badly get a job that has access to a scope (you may have to actually move out of your city) or go to a university and talk to a professor.

kek

>'-'
se mate

Eu até doaria alguma coisinha cara, mas não temos nenhuma garantia além de uma historinha numa imageboard, assim fica complicado...

It was a waste to type this on Jow Forums, people here are autistics who can't program anything but hello world and fizzbuzz (In languages that don't matter in the real world)

I wish you the best of luck, though.

>Hello guys! I'm [Meatspace identity] from [HUEHUE meatspace shithole]
Die. I don't care how, just die.
>since there's no source or public build, It would be nonsense
And it's still nonsense here for the exact same reason. As it would be everywhere else.

Try asking on reddit, basically everything emulation related happens there. Also, don't expect anyone believing you without some proof.

Pick a platform that doesn't have a good emulator and do that instead.

install gentoo

Like DS? DeSmuME is fucking cancer and anything else is outright broken. If OP is really telling the truth, I hope he succeeds.

OP is already struggling to reverse engineer a platform that's somewhat documented and has working open source emulators, I'm not sure if that would help much.

I played every DS Megaman and Castlevania games since 2010 with No$Gba 2.6a lmao.
The only annoying thing is lacking of zooming feature.

DeSmuME's problems are mostly in management and audiovisual output. Just fork it to fix the former and code it to fix the latter. The codebase isn't so bad you'd need to start from scratch.

But if you want hope from some potentially competent developers, then go and convince Exophase to port DraStic to PC, preferably open sourcing it while doing so.
Some random BR scam on Jow Forums isn't a place for hope.

>DeSmuME is fucking cancer and anything else is outright broken.
What's wrong with DeSmuME? I havent used it in ages but I remember it working okay.

If OP was telling the truth and wanted to create an open source, portable, well-written DS emulator, why didn't he put it on GitLab or something where people could contribute or at least verify a commit history etc. of his work? It would sure lend a lot of credibility to his story.

How about an iPhone/iOS emulator

google.com/search?q=No$Zoomer

Which parts of GBATek are inaccurate? I need to know this.

I would rather use Desmume instead of No Zoomer

Of course. Just saying that's not an issue, if No$GBA is good enough for the task for that person.

Make a Patreon

My old trick is set the resolution to 640x480 for only No$GBA

I remember doing that for countless programs when fullscreen was borked and they had tiny resolutions. But Zoomer was out by time I started to use that one so there was no need.

>What's wrong with DeSmuME?
Nothing. The mentally ill dev of another DS emulator has turned R****t against DeSmuME with lies and slander. Anyone shitting on it here is a R****tor.

>I havent used it in ages but I remember it working okay.
Have you played any pokemon on it?

>not having different words for both things

English is so retarded, shittiest lingua franca in hitory

No, but why would I do that when NetBattle and ShoddyBattle exist?

>not realizing that free as in free speech and free as in free beer are basically the same sort of freedom in that the good, service, or ability to do some activity is not anyone's property or is collective property

>NetBattle and ShoddyBattle

Attached: 1477698383804.jpg (511x428, 37K)

>a mentally ill dev has committed terrorism wah ree wah ree

is this /agdg/?

t. zeromus

Attached: 1515115800739.png (359x255, 214K)

>furfag
kys senpai

Before the end of the second post I was actually proud to be Brazilian... But it all went straight downhill from there.

shut up retard

holy SHIT that was fast, deleted before the page even refreshed on my end, wtf mods

no one likes furfags

>we don't want him
>we
we don't want you either

Thanks, we shall stay.

Kickstarter or something

we need you to go

>we
If OP is not just a scammer, who are you to say if you want him or not? kys faggot

Attached: 1407091453842.jpg (762x668, 42K)

UMA

>an Nintendo

>If OP is not just a scammer
That's an impossible precedent though. What's the point of an if statement that never EVER runs true?

Once you figure out that reddit's jokes are all normalfag tier it becomes easy to pick them apart

Fuck you
>>>/global/rules/11

sopa

kys faggot

sent :^)

>gib money I report u huehuehue
No, my man

It's been done, m8.

Why is this dogshit still up?

Attached: 1406690719392.jpg (534x355, 27K)

sounds like those email scams from the mid 00s

I would buy one for 50$, but I can't donate a dollar to anyone in the world because politics forbidden e-money in my cunt.

Attached: emu.jpg (1600x1200, 137K)

Free as in free beer is just a contraction of the phrase free of charge meaning free as in freedom of charge.

why the best android emulator had to be on fucking android out of all the systems is mind boggling